*Dior and I* transcends the typical fashion documentary by focusing on the human element. While the exquisite garments and breathtaking runway show are undeniably captivating, the film’s true strength lies in its portrayal of the passionate individuals who bring the Dior vision to life. We witness the tireless dedication of the ateliers' seamstresses, their nimble fingers transforming sketches into breathtaking realities. We see the collaborative spirit of the design team, their creative tensions and breakthroughs forming the backbone of the collection's development. And we witness Raf Simons himself, grappling with the immense pressure of inheriting a legacy and forging his own unique mark on the house of Dior.
